Carolyn “Betty” McCormick

Carolyn Elizabeth Schettgen McCormick, 91, of Demopolis, died Saturday, July 6 at her residence. She was born March 23, 1922, in Jefferson County to George Alphonse and Eloise Rachel Schettgen. She was preceded in death by her husband, James Guy McCormick Jr.; and sister, Eldra Louise Schettgen Hallman. She is survived by her brother, Eugene Frederick Schettgen of Atlanta, Ga.; nieces, Lindsey Hallman (Walker) Wilson of Jasper, Peyton Hallman (Ted) Kennel of Ringgold, Ga., Kim Schettgen of Atlanta, and Kerri Schettgen of Atlanta; and nephews, Victor (Monica) Hallman of Birmingham, Christopher (Charlene) Hallman of Pinson, and Tyler (Maury) Hallman of Mountain Brook. A member of the Bryan W. Whitfield Memorial Hospital Auxiliary since 1993, Mrs. McCormick was an avid supporter of the hospital. An annual scholarship awarded by the Auxiliary to children and grandchildren of hospital employees is named in her honor.
